Warner Bros. has confirmed the February 28, 2023 release of Rocky: The Knockout Collection in 4K Ultra HD. In addition to HDR10, the films also include Dolby Vision. However, only the first four films are included in the collection on disc. “Rocky V” and “Rocky Balboa” are unfortunately missing for the time being.

February 28, 2023 was initially only confirmed as the release date for the USA. But I expect a release in Germany soon. Of course, the “Rocky” series should not only appear on disc in 4K, but also on the common digital platforms. A special treat: The collection also includes “Rocky IV” in the new version “Rocky vs. Drago: The Ultimate Director’s Cut”. This is a new cut version of Sylvester Stallone.

The latter is also rumored to be the reason why “Rocky V” and “Rocky Balboa” are not included. Stallone is probably also working on new cut versions for those two films, which is why they will be submitted later.
